Command line option to reload settings / proxy?
Posted: Mon Oct 19, 2015 11:32 am
Hi all,
I have Qbittorrent-nox running on a RPI2. All is great, but for one issue which I believe is fairly common - I'm using a socks5 proxy, and after a certain amount of time without activity I need to manually trigger the proxy info to reload by opening the options menu in the GUI and clicking save.
This isn't the biggest problem in the world, but I wondered if there was a way to automate the reload. I wondered if there was a command line option that would have the reloading effect I could use in conjunction with crontab?
